New to C#.
Using C# Express

When I try and use "Help" I get this message:

The request failed with HTTP status 407: Proxy Authentication Required ( The
ISA Server requires authorization to fulfil the request. Access to the Web
Proxy service is denied. )

My PC gets to the internet and newsgroups through ISA server without
problems, so what's going on here?

How do I resolve the problem?
